Q: Is 22,570,632 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 22,570,632 is a composite number.

Why is 22,570,632 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 22,570,632 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 8 9 12 14 18 19 21 24 28 36 38 42 56 57 63 72 76 84 114 126 133 152 168 171 228 252 266 342 399 456 504 532 684 798 1,064 1,197 1,368 1,596 2,357 2,394 3,192 4,714 4,788 7,071 9,428 9,576 14,142 16,499 18,856 21,213 28,284 32,998 42,426 44,783 49,497 56,568 65,996 84,852 89,566 98,994 131,992 134,349 148,491 169,704 179,132 197,988 268,698 296,982 313,481 358,264 395,976 403,047 537,396 593,964 626,962 806,094 940,443 1,074,792 1,187,928 1,253,924 1,612,188 1,880,886 2,507,848 2,821,329 3,224,376 3,761,772 5,642,658 7,523,544 11,285,316 and 22,570,632, with no remainder.

Since 22,570,632 cannot be divided by just 1 and 22,570,632, it is a composite number.
